In 1860, Minnie Carver Robinson entered the world in Centralia, Illinois, United States of America, born to James Ignatius Logan And Unity Jane Livesay. In 1880, Minnie Carver Robinson resided in Saint Helena, Napa, California, USA. Minnie Carver Robinson passed away in 1943 in Saint Helena, Napa County, California, United States of America.
